Higher Rate Tax Threshold
One or both salaries cross the higher rate threshold (£50,271.00). Above this, you pay 40% tax on additional earnings, so the actual take-home difference is smaller than it appears.
- Pension contributions above £50,271 save 40% tax - very valuable
- Consider salary sacrifice schemes for electric cars or cycle-to-work
- Above £60k, child benefit starts being clawed back (if applicable)
- Equity or bonus structures may be more tax-efficient than base salary

Comparison Results
| Metric | £64,339 | £73,839 | Difference |
|---|---|---|---|
| Gross Salary | £64,339 | £73,839 | £9,500 |
| Income Tax | £13,168 | £16,968 | £3,800 |
| National Insurance | £3,297 | £3,487 | £190 |
| Pension | £0 | £0 | £0 |
| Take-Home Pay (Yearly) | £47,874 | £53,384 | £5,510 |
| Take-Home (Monthly) | £3,990 | £4,449 | £459 |
| Effective Tax Rate | 25.6% | 27.7% | 2.1% |
